>I prefer FICS. I dont like ICC for a few reasons. First i have to pay. Second
>big problem is their Blitzin interface. AFAIK its spyware and works only in
>Windows. Third you have to pay even more if you want to play with GMs. GM plays
>there only with other GM and time control is usually 3 0. Watching GM 3 0 games
>is NOT improving your own game. In FICS registration is free and ALL games are
>also free.

Try the "Thief interface" at this link. I like it very much as you can give the
board just about any color you like and it has quite a variety of pieces to
choose from and you can make the board to a very nice size. I tried several
interfaces that are available and come to like this one the best! It's was also
rated the best interface to play bughouse and some of the other non-traditional
varieties.
